Paulsen is In-House Counsel for CRST International, Incorporated. He has also been Shirt Production Supervisor with Cryovac from 1997-2003, and served in the United States Air Force from 1987-1997.[1]

Elections
2010
Paulsen is running for re-election to the 35th District Seat in 2010 with no opposition. He was also unopposed in the Republican primary. The general election takes place on November 2, 2010.
2008
On November 4, 2008, Paulsen was re-elected to the 35th District Seat in the Iowa House of Representatives, defeating Mike Robinson (D). [2] Paulsen raised $357,761 for his campaign, while Robinson raised $8,919. [3]

Campaign Donors
2008
In 2008 Paulsen collected $357,761 in donations.[4]
His four largest contributors were:
| Donor | Amount |
|---|---|
| Iowans for Tax Relief | $24,000 |
| Ayers, James W. | $20,000 |
| Iowa Credit Union League | $11,500 |
| Wal-Mart | $11,000 |
